(#pragma alloca): Add if _AIX is defined.
(path-concat.h): Include. (show_point): If HAVE_REALPATH or HAVE_RESOLVEPATH is defined, find the real absolute path for PATH, and use that to find the mount point. (show_point): Prefer non-dummy entries in shortcuts, too. Disable bogus mount dirs instead of restatting them each time.
